How do you get downloads onto a phone with a music player?

To be more specific, I'm considering getting a Chocolate phone and I was wondering if you could transfer downloads from limewire, etc. onto the phone. Does it have to downloaded directly from the phone company's service?

Public Comments

  1. you need a usb kit
  2. I have a verizon phone, but not the chocolate. I bought a USB Data Cable off ebay that is compatible to my phone. I got mine less then $10! It allows you to get any mp3 files and let them go inside your phone (I also suggest buying a memory card). Once you have done so, hook the cable to your computer and your cellphone, go to Get Tunes & Tones -> Sync Music -> Use a program to sychronize the song into your cellphone. I suggest using Windows Media Player as it has helped me countless of times. For ringtones etc, go download BitPim.
